Are the Museums and Historical Sights Better in Riga or Thessaloniki?

Riga
Thessaloniki

Plenty of people visit the high quality sights and museums in both Riga and Thessaloniki.

Riga offers many unique museums, sights, and landmarks that will make for a memorable trip. As a capital city with a diverse history, you'll find a number of museums and landmarks in the area. Visitors frequently visit The Freedom Monument, St. Peters Church, the Riga Cathedral, The House of the Black Heads, and any of the many museums around town.

Many visitors head to Thessaloniki specifically to visit some of its top-rated museums and other sights. There are a huge number of historic and archeological sights in the city. These include the Rotunda of Galerius, the White Tower, the Church of Agios Dimitrios, and the Arch of Galerius.


Is the Food Better in Riga or Thessaloniki? Which Destination has the Best Restaurants?

Riga
Thessaloniki

Both Riga and Thessaloniki offer a number of high quality restaurants to choose from.

Eating is part of the travel experience when you visit Riga. The city offers a great opportunity to try many Latvian specialties including rasol (a potato salad), pelmeni (a Latvian dumpling), and karbonade (kind of like schnitzel). The cuisine is hearty and filling with lots of bread, dumpling, and meats. Riga is also where you'll find the largest food market in Europe, which is the perfect place to wander and pick up some local items.

Thessaloniki has a number of nationally recognized food spots and restaurants. There's a huge culinary scene in the city, and you'll find everything from fun street food options to traditional tavernas and even some great international restaurants.

Which place is cheaper, Thessaloniki or Riga?

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ations.

The average daily cost (per person) in Riga is €104, while the average daily cost in Thessaloniki is €134.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. While every person is different, these costs are an average of past travelers in each destination. What follows is a categorical breakdown of travel costs for Riga and Thessaloniki in more detail.

When is the best time to visit Riga or Thessaloniki?

Both places have a temperate climate with four distinct seasons. As both cities are in the northern hemisphere, summer is in July and winter is in January.

Should I visit Riga or Thessaloniki in the Summer?

Both Thessaloniki and Riga during the summer are popular places to visit. The summer months attract visitors to Riga because of the city activities and the family-friendly experiences. Also, the beaches, the city activities, and the family-friendly experiences are the main draw to Thessaloniki this time of year.

Riga is cooler than Thessaloniki in the summer. The daily temperature in Riga averages around 17°C (63°F) in July, and Thessaloniki fluctuates around 25°C (77°F).

Riga usually gets more rain in July than Thessaloniki. Riga gets 79 mm (3.1 in) of rain, while Thessaloniki receives 26 mm (1 in) of rain this time of the year.


  • Summer Average Temperatures July
    Riga 17°C (63°F) 
    Thessaloniki 25°C (77°F)

Typical Weather for Thessaloniki and Riga

Riga Thessaloniki
Temp (°C) Rain (mm) Temp (°C) Rain (mm)
Jan -5°C (23°F) 33 mm (1.3 in) 5°C (41°F) 37 mm (1.5 in)
Feb -4°C (24°F) 25 mm (1 in) 7°C (44°F) 40 mm (1.6 in)
Mar -0°C (31°F) 31 mm (1.2 in) 9°C (49°F) 46 mm (1.8 in)
Apr 5°C (42°F) 39 mm (1.5 in) 13°C (56°F) 36 mm (1.4 in)
May 12°C (53°F) 43 mm (1.7 in) 18°C (65°F) 44 mm (1.7 in)
Jun 15°C (60°F) 61 mm (2.4 in) 23°C (73°F) 32 mm (1.3 in)
Jul 17°C (63°F) 79 mm (3.1 in) 25°C (77°F) 26 mm (1 in)
Aug 16°C (62°F) 79 mm (3.1 in) 25°C (76°F) 21 mm (0.8 in)
Sep 12°C (54°F) 76 mm (3 in) 21°C (70°F) 26 mm (1 in)
Oct 7°C (45°F) 60 mm (2.4 in) 16°C (61°F) 41 mm (1.6 in)
Nov 2°C (36°F) 61 mm (2.4 in) 11°C (52°F) 58 mm (2.3 in)
Dec -2°C (28°F) 49 mm (1.9 in) 7°C (44°F) 53 mm (2.1 in)
